SafeRag SE is a private, local-first AI chat app for macOS that lets you have intelligent conversations with your documents — all without sending a single byte to the cloud.
Chat with Your Documents
Import PDFs, Word documents, text files, web pages, and more. SafeRag SE uses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) to search your documents and provide accurate, sourced answers. Ask questions,
get summaries, compare documents, and extract key information — all powered by AI that runs entirely on your Mac.
Completely Private
Your data never leaves your device. SafeRag SE runs local language models using llama.cpp, optimized for Apple Silicon. No API keys, no cloud services, no subscriptions. Your documents stay on
your Mac where they belong.
Apple Intelligence Ready
On macOS 26 and later, SafeRag SE integrates with Apple Foundation Models for seamless on-device AI. Choose between local llama.cpp models, Apple Intelligence, or connect to a local Ollama server
— the choice is yours.
Built for macOS
SafeRag SE is a native SwiftUI app designed for Mac. It follows Apple's Human Interface Guidelines, supports light and dark mode, and feels right at home on your desktop.
Key Features
- Import PDFs, DOCX, TXT, HTML, EPUB, and web pages
- RAG-powered document Q&A with source attribution
- Download and manage GGUF models directly in the app
- Watch folders for automatic document import
- Multi-session chat with history
- Optional password encryption for your conversations
- Prompt templates for common tasks (summarize, explain, compare, find)
- Adjustable font sizes and appearance settings
- Keyboard shortcuts for power users
Supported Document Formats
PDF, DOCX, TXT, RTF, HTML, EPUB, Markdown, CSV, and ZIP archives containing supported files. Simply drag and drop or use the document manager to build your knowledge base.
Requirements
- Apple Silicon Mac (M1 or later)
- macOS 14.0 Sonoma or later
- At least 8 GB RAM recommended for local model inference
